So far, so good. The line is staying together with no signs of strong rotation in it as it nears the state line. One of the areas of concern was Southern central AR south of Little Rock. CAMs had shown cells firing ahead of the line. They are, but fortunately a little farther north than modeled. That area got worked over by rain earlier today. There's essentially a warm front draped across that area that could have acted as a trigger for storms. That hasn't been the case so far.
This is strictly speaking to the tornado concern. This line is still going carry some significant wind. That's a given with a line that's moving at 75mph per the warning.
